Your Clergy
Father David Andrew (aka Father D) is a graduate of Ryerson University (Dispensing Optician), McMaster University (Certificate in Addiction Studies) and the University of Ottawa - St. Paul (BTh.) After a career of nearly 30 years in the optical industry he was called to the priesthood later in life.
Ordained Deacon on the Feast of the Ascension on May 13, 1999 and ordained priest on the Feast of St. Andrew, November 30, 1999, he has served the Parish of Clayton and the Parish of St. Mary the Virgin prior to being appointed Rector of St. James, Carleton Place in June of 2007.
From July 2002 until June of 2004, he had the privilege of serving as Interim Rector of St. Katherine of Alexandria Episcopal Church in Baltimore, Maryland and has served as interim priest at various parishes in the Diocese of Ottawa.
Father David is married to his wonderfully patient wife, Toni Moffa, and has care and control (sometimes!) of son Jamie and daughter Rachel, and Derby the family’s Golden Retriever!
